Broken windows can cause leaks and draughts that consume energy. This can lead to high heating costs. The moisture that is trapped within the frames could rot them and cause health issues for you and your family.
Double pane windows are made up of two identical glass units, separated by a spacer which is filled with argon or air. They are an excellent energy saving solution that helps to reduce your winter heating costs and reduce the cost of cooling in summer.
Misty Windows
Double glazing is a great investment for your home. It can save you money on energy bills, keep the inside of your home warm and secure, and improve its aesthetics. However, it may become damaged or fade over time. This could be due the weather or use of cleaning chemicals. It can also be caused by the seal being broken between two panes. This could cause the windows to become cloudy or get misty.
This issue can be addressed. Many glaziers will replace the sealed unit inside the window instead of replacing the frame and glass. They can also install new frames, if needed. However, the most important factor in preventing misty windows is to avoid using chemical cleaners or harsh cleaning products. These chemicals can harm the seal that insulates and cause moisture to leak through the glass.
A glazier can assess the problem and make an assessment and offer suggestions. They will likely need to conduct an investigation prior to providing you with a price, as they will have to measure the frames and windows in order to determine the best replacement sealed units.
The glazier will replace the window using the appropriate materials after the survey is completed. The glazier will inspect the windows and make sure that they work correctly. This includes monitoring the temperature in your home.
It is important to fix your windows as soon as you can when they are leaking. This will stop mould and damp from growing within your home which could be harmful to both the structure of your home as well as your health. A damp and mouldy home can lead to respiratory problems allergies, asthma, and auto-immune diseases. Making sure that your windows are replaced promptly will help to reduce the risk of these problems, and also ensure that your double-glazed windows are functioning to its maximum potential.

Condensation inside
If condensation is visible on the inside of your double-glazed windows, it's not necessarily a sign that they're not functioning properly and are not performing as they ought to. It could be an indicator that there is too much moisture in the air or not enough air flow within the room or building. This is often the case if you've recently hired builders or other tradesmen working on your property as wet cement, wet plaster and paint release a lot of moisture.
This can be resolved by opening the windows slightly or by using an extractor fan. Leaving a window open during the night will also help. Try to create shade around windows and doors. This will help reduce the amount of moisture generated by direct sunlight.
If you see condensation between your windows it could be due to an issue with the spacers between the window panes. It is the space between two panes of glass and contains desiccant materials that absorb any moisture or water. However, if the spacer has any sort of damage, this will quickly become saturated and excess moisture will then appear as condensation.
A issue with the sealant could also be responsible for the condensation between your window panes. If your windows were installed by a reputable company that has an insurance-backed guarantee, this is more likely to occur.
Repairing the sealant between your double glazed windows will require the unit to be removed. This is a difficult job and is not something that should be attempted without proper training or experience since it is possible that you'll damage the glass or cause further damage. It is possible to repair misted double glazing near me the unit in a cost-effective manner by companies that specialize in this type of work. They usually make one or two holes into the pane of glass or in the spacer bars. They then pump or inject the sealed unit with an anti-fogging or drying agent.

A replacement IG unit is a sophisticated unit that provides significantly more thermal efficiency than traditional single or double-glazed windows. The new units are designed to be slim and fit into existing frames, so you don't have to worry about changing the appearance of your home. The modern materials and insulation technologies are used to make them more energy efficient.
Modern IG units are typically comprised of an outer layer of glass with low-emissivity and an inner layer of clear float with a space between the two filled with air or inert gas, such as argon or krypton. The inert gas slows down the transfer of heat, which helps to keep your home warm.
